AUDIO PROCESSING SYSTEM AND AUDIO PROCESSING METHOD THEREOF |
摘要 |
An audio processing system and an audio processing method thereof are provided. A first audio signal and at least one second audio signal from different directions are received by audio receivers. A first component signal and a second component signal are calculated by separating the first audio signal. A third component signal and a fourth component signal are calculated by separating the second audio signal. A major voice information is obtained by calculating the first component signal and the third component signal. A non-major voice information is obtained by calculating the second component signal and the fourth component signal. The non-major voice information is subtracted from the first audio signal to obtain a calculation result. The calculation result and the major voice information are added to obtain a major voice signal in the first audio signal and the at least one second audio signal. |

1. An audio processing method, adapted to an audio processing system comprising an audio receiving device, wherein the audio receiving device comprises a plurality of audio receivers, the audio processing method comprising the following steps:
receiving a first audio signal and at least one second audio signal from different directions by the audio receivers; calculating a first component signal and a second component signal by separating the first audio signal; calculating a third component signal and a fourth component signal by separating each of the at least one second audio signal; obtaining a major voice information by calculating the first component signal and the at least one third component signal; obtaining a non-major voice information by calculating the second component signal and the at least one fourth component signal; subtracting the non-major voice information from the first audio signal to obtain a calculation result; and adding the calculation result and the major voice information to obtain a major voice signal in the first audio signal and the at least one second audio signal. |
